                O ptimum Nutrition's Serious Mass is a weight gain supplement with high caloric content targeted to serious athletes and bodybuilders.   What is Serious Mass?   Serious Mass is a high-calorie weight gainer from Optimum Nutrition . It is designed to help people who are struggling to gain weight.   The main ingredients are protein, carbohydrates, and fats. It also contains vitamins, minerals, and enzymes. The calories come from a blend of maltodextrin, whey protein concentrate, casein, egg whites, and oils.   There are several different flavors of Serious Mass, including chocolate, vanilla, strawberry, cookies and cream. There are also two sizes - 2.73kg and 5.4kg.   The recommended serving size is two heaping scoops (174g) mixed with 16-24 fluid ounces of water or milk.
